Toyota ClassicWoodford County 55, Louisville Western 51
Landen Young led all scorers with 20 points and Jay Johnson chipped in with 16 as Woodford County used a 22-12 third quarter to top Western, 55-51, and move into the semi-finals of the 2012 Toyota Classic.
Woodford led, 14-12, after the first quarter and 25-22 at the half. The third quarter explosion by the Yellow Jackets put them up, 47-34, after three quarters but a frantic Warriors comeback in the final period cut the gap to the final, four-point margin.
Charles Jacobs paced the Warriors with 14 points and Chris McGraw added a dozen. David Greenwell was the third Yellow Jacket in twin figures with 11 points and led Woodford County with seven rebounds. Kenneth Wachira led Western with seven rebounds.
Woodford County outshot Western from the field, 42.3% - 40%. The Warriors had a one rebound edge over the Yellow Jackets, 33-32. Each team turned the ball over more than 20 times – Woodford’s 21 turnovers leading to 16 Western points while Western’s twenty miscues led to 16 Jackets points.
